0.5M Triphenylphosphine in methylene chloride and diisopropyl azodicarboxylate (150 μl, 0.75 mmol) were added in portions to a suspension of 7-hydroxy-6-methoxy-4-(2-methylindol-5-yloxy)quinazoline (112 mg, 0.35 mmol), (prepared as described in Example 49), and N,N-dimethylethanolamine (62 mg, 0.7 mmol) in methylene chloride (2 ml). After stirring for 2 hours at ambient temperature, the reaction mixture was poured onto an Isolute® column (10 g of silica) and eluted with ethyl acetate/methylene chloride (1/1) followed by methanol/ethyl acetate/methylene chloride (10/40/50), methanol/methylene chloride (10/90), and 3M ammonia in methanol/methanol/methylene chloride (5/15/80). After removal of the volatiles by evaporation, the residue was dissolved in the minimum amount of methylene chloride (about 3 ml) and ether and petroleum ether (about 10 ml) was added. The resulting precipitate was collected by filtration and dried under vacuum to give 7-(2-(N,N-dimethylamino)ethoxy)-6-methoxy-4-(2-methylindol-5-yloxy)quinazoline (52 mg, 38%).
